PitchForce is a weekly competition-style event for early-stage startups to deliver a 4-minute pitch with a slide deck to a panel of seasoned investors. There will be a Q&A session with the panel and direct feedback from the panel before they vote on a scale of 1 to 5. 6 startups seeking their seed round will deliver a 4-minute pitch with a slide presentation followed by a Q&A session with the panel, followed by panel non-rebuttal feedback. The panelists will vote on a scale of 1-5 (5 being the highest) to rate the company.
All pitching startups will receive a $5000 PeopleConnect search credit.
Companies that do well often secure meetings with the investors on the panel and/or investors that are in our attendee audience resulting in discussions that lead to investment!Want To Pitch?

Step 1: Startups will be connected to the UC Berkeley Extension team at the beginning of the week of the event. The Extension team will provide logistical details and the event link.
Step 2: During the event, startups will have 6 minutes to pitch, and 2 mins for questions from featured judges and attendees (which would also include investors).
Step 3: Following the main event, there will be a separate session where each startup presenter will have 12 minutes to meet with a featured judge assigned based on fit. The judge and startup will also be connected by email the day before the event.
Step 4: The registered startup company’s name and information will be sent out to our network of investors via our newsletter for increased visibility with a broader number of investors for the startup.For questions, please email: startups@pitchglobal.com
